Résumé
Arctic adventure. Aviation frontier. River-runner legend. While Norman Grant and Roy Moulton chase glory in their airship the Gitchie Manitou, a rival machine - sleek, secret, and financed by a fur baron with a grudge - is racing them to Fort McMurray by way of the Athabasca River. Riding the sturgeon-head batteaux with the last great steersmen of the North is seventeen-year-old Étienne La Biche, son of the legendary riverman, who has spent his life reading rapids instead of maps and who trusts a paddle more than a propeller. When Colonel Howell's expedition and a shadow expedition converge on the same stretch of wilderness, Étienne is pulled into a world of aeroplanes, blizzards, wolf packs, fur-trade conspiracy, and a vanished prospector's cache that could ruin the Hudson's Bay Company's grip on the frozen North.
He must survive the rapids of the Grand Rapids portage, outrun a rival brigade, decode a dead man's map, and decide whether the future belongs to the river or the sky - before winter closes the Arctic like a fist.
